Retrieval-Free Suggestion Question Generation via Large Language Models

2025-02-26

Abstract excerpt

This paper addresses the challenge of ambiguous and poorly formulated user queries in Retrieval-Augmented Generation (RAG) based conversational systems. Current RAG systems often struggle to provide satisfactory responses to such queries, hindering user experience. To mitigate this issue, we propose a novel approach for suggestion question generation that moves beyond traditional retrieval-based methods. Our metho...
